## Signing Tilecache Artifacts

Quick note for reviewers: every build of the Quenby tile-rendering cache layer must ship with a signed manifest, or the Ostermere edge nodes will reject it on warm-up. The CI job handles hashing; you just verify the signature matches before approving the merge. For local verification, use the signing key below:

release key, kajep-kawep: bky6_6NQiA4

## Further reading

New to Quarrelbox? Start with the sandbox model. User-supplied formulas run in the Tinderbox interpreter with no filesystem, network, or clock access; resource limits are enforced per evaluation. Never bypass the sandbox for "trusted" tenants — that assumption caused the Marrow Lake incident. Before touching `sandbox/` or the allowlist, read the threat model and the escape-hatch policy. Both documents, plus the incident writeup, are collected on the internal page here.

runbook for badug-kadup: https://confluence.zemvarlabs.internal/projects/browse/display/projects/bd1b

**14:22** — Okay, so this is where it got weird. The Garagio occupancy feed started reporting 112% capacity for the Northquay deck, and our poller happily cached it. Turns out the stall counter double-counted motorcycles. Priya rolled back the ingest worker and counts normalized within six minutes. The bad build is identified by the trace token below.

pipeline stamp: htk9_82d907462